The Cost of Replacing a Down Jackets Shell
The cost of replacing a down jackets shell can vary depending on the material, brand, and design of the jacket. In general, however, replacing a down jackets shell can be a relatively expensive proposition. The cost of the new shell alone can range from several hundred dollars to well over a thousand dollars, depending on the quality and material chosen. Additionally, labor costs can also add significantly to the final bill, especially if the job is done by a professional tailor or seamstress. Therefore, before deciding to replace the shell of a down jacket, it is important to carefully consider the cost and whether it is truly necessary. In some cases, it may be more economical to simply purchase a new down jacket altogether.

Factors Affecting the Cost of Replacing a Down Jacket's Shell
1、Brand and Model of the Jacket: High-end brands and models of down jackets tend to have more expensive shells made from higher-quality materials. Therefore, replacing the shell for these jackets will usually cost more than for lower-end models.
2、Material of the Shell: The material used to make the shell of the down jacket can greatly affect the cost of replacement. Higher-quality materials, such as nylon or polyester, tend to be more expensive than lower-quality materials, such as cotton or acrylic.
3、Size and Weight of the Jacket: Larger and heavier down jackets require more material to make, which can drive up the cost of replacing the shell. Conversely, smaller and lighter jackets will usually have a lower replacement cost.
4、Design and Complexity of the Jacket: Some down jackets have complex designs or patterns on the shell, which can increase the cost of replacement. Simple, solid-colored jackets will usually have a lower replacement cost than those with intricate patterns or designs.
Tips on Saving Money on a Down Jacket Shell Replacement
1、Purchase a Less Expensive Model: As mentioned above, high-end brands and models of down jackets tend to have more expensive shells. To save money on the replacement cost, consider purchasing a less expensive model of down jacket. This doesn't mean sacrificing quality; there are many affordable options available that still offer great warmth and durability.
2、Use a Local Tailor or Sewing Shop: Taking your down jacket to a local tailor or sewing shop for repairs can often be less expensive than sending it back to the manufacturer or using a specialized repair service. Many tailors and sewing shops offer repair services, and they may be able to fix or replace the shell for a fraction of the cost of new jacket.
3、DIY Repairs: If you're handy with a needle and thread, you may be able to make simple repairs to your down jacket yourself. For example, you can patch small tears or punctures using a matching thread and needle, or replace zippers and other fasteners that may have become damaged. This can help you avoid having to replace the entire shell and save money in the process.
